No. 3 Daniel Defense Chevrolet Camaro at Dover Speedway

Black Creek, GA– Daniel Defense, manufacturer of the world's finest firearms and accessories, is pleased to announce the debut of the No. 3 Daniel Defense Chevrolet Camaro in the NASCAR XFINITY Series OneMain Financial 200. The race will take place at Dover International Speedway on Saturday, June 3 at 1 p.m. Eastern Standard Time.

The Dover race will mark the first of three XFINITY Series races in which Daniel Defense will be the primary sponsor of the Richard Childress Racing No. 3 Chevrolet Camaro. As part of Daniel Defense's primary sponsorship, the legendary car, driven by Ty Dillon, will be fully wrapped in Daniel Defense's yellow and black and feature the signature Double D's across the hood of the car. Daniel Defense will also be an associate sponsor on the car for 16 additional races during the 2017 season in which the Daniel Defense logo will be located just over the rear side windows of the car.

Daniel Defense's NASCAR debut is part of an evolving partnership with RCR. The Daniels became acquainted with NASCAR Hall of Fame team owner Richard Childress through their involvement with the National Rifle Association. Currently serving as the First Vice President for the National Rifle Association, Childress is no stranger to the firearms industry. "Our shared core values and, specifically, a commitment to the Second Amendment has shaped the relationship we have today," said Daniel.

Childress' youngest grandson Ty Dillon will serve as the primary driver of the No. 3 Chevrolet Camaro during the 2017 season. Dillon, who has competed in the XFINITY Series full time in each of the last three seasons, will race select XFINITY Series races in 2017 while also competing full time in the Monster Energy NASCAR Cup Series. Dillon finished fifth in the XFINITY Series standings in 2016.

About Richard Childress Racing
Richard Childress Racing (rcrracing.com) is a renowned, performance-driven racing, marketing and manufacturing organization. RCR has earned more than 200 victories and 17 championships, including six in the Monster Energy NASCAR Cup Series with the legendary Dale Earnhardt. RCR was the first organization to win championships in the NASCAR Cup Series, NASCAR XFINITY Series and NASCAR Camping World Truck Series.
